Effect of LBE corrosion on microstructure of amorphous Al2O3 coating by magnetron sputtering

摘要
The amorphous Al2O3 coating with a thickness of approximately 3.3 mu m was prepared on ferritic/martensitic steel to investigate the corrosion resistance in contact with static liquid lead-bismuth eutectic from 100 h to 1000 h at 550 degrees C. The results showed that Al2O3 coating had poor wettability and could effectively protect the substrate from liquid lead-bismuth eutectic corrosion. However, the structure of the coating changed from an amorphous phase to a dual-phase structure during the corrosion process, leading to the formation of voids. The microscopic corrosion mechanism of Al2O3 coating was also elucidated in detail.
